Debt and its impact on credit ratings

Paisley Daily Express

|

June 12, 2026

I have been a bit worried about my outstanding debt. I am managing all my monthly payments but I do find it difficult. I want to consider all my options but my main concern is my credit report. Are there any options that wouldn’t impact my credit rating?

My current car finance agreement is ending soon, and I will need to get a new one as a car is necessary for work. I really don’t want to be unable to get finance.

There are lots of good options for managing debt, however, these will affect your credit rating.

If you make an arrangement, either through the Debt Arrangement Scheme, or through an informal arrangement with your creditors to reduce your payment, it is very likely this will be recorded on your credit report.

The creditors will issue a default notice to the credit reference agencies when contractual payments have not been made. They might also log the payments as late if they are lower than expected under the original contract.

This does not mean you cannot get a new car finance agreement, but it could make it much more difficult.
